Practically proof against harm when he played, Speaker experienced a number of health conditions in his afterwards many years. In 1937 he fractured his skull and broke his left arm when he fell 16 feet from the 2nd-Tale porch at his home. He also experienced a around-deadly perforated intestine and b52 club was hospitalized for months after a heart ailment in 1954.

When Tris Speaker was a younger cowboy in Texas, he experienced a damaged proper arm in a very fall from a horse and became a still left-handed pitcher. Then his left arm was wounded inside a football incident.
As participant-manager for Cleveland, he led the staff to its 1st World Series title. In 7 of his eleven seasons with Cleveland, he completed that has a batting average bigger than .350. Speaker resigned as Cleveland's supervisor in 1926 soon after he and Ty Cobb confronted sport-fixing allegations; both Guys had been afterwards cleared. Throughout his managerial stint in Cleveland, Speaker launched the platoon procedure in the key leagues.
Within the day that Speaker arrived in Cleveland, he was proficiently assistant supervisor to Lee Fohl, who almost never made a crucial transfer with no consulting him. George Uhle recalled an incident from 1919 during his rookie year Using the Indians. Speaker typically signaled to Fohl when he considered that a pitcher needs to be brought in in the bullpen.

By the time Tris Speaker turned 22, he was by now one of the better Heart fielders in the sport, a player highly regarded for both of those his do the job with the plate and in the field. A Texas native, Speaker began his vocation Along with the Red Sox, wherever he had among the finest seasons of his job in 1912.
